     41 /*
     42  * Scan the directory dirname calling selectfn to make a list of selected
     43  * directory entries then sort using qsort and compare routine dcomp.
     44  * Returns the number of entries and a pointer to a list of pointers to
     45  * struct dirent (through namelist). Returns -1 if there were any errors.
     46  */
     47 
     48 #include "namespace.h"
     49 #include <sys/types.h>
     50 #include <sys/stat.h>
     51 
     52 #include <assert.h>
     53 #include <errno.h>
     54 #include <dirent.h>
     55 #include <stdlib.h>
     56 #include <string.h>
     57 
     58 int
     59 scandir(dirname, namelist, selectfn, dcomp)
     60 	const char *dirname;
     61 	struct dirent ***namelist;
     62 	int (*selectfn) __P((const struct dirent *));
     63 	int (*dcomp) __P((const void *, const void *));
     64 {
     65 	struct dirent *d, *p, **names, **newnames;
     66 	size_t nitems, arraysz;
     67 	struct stat stb;
     68 	DIR *dirp;
     69 
     70 	_DIAGASSERT(dirname != NULL);
     71 	_DIAGASSERT(namelist != NULL);
     72 
     73 	if ((dirp = opendir(dirname)) == NULL)
     74 		return (-1);
     75 	if (fstat(dirp->dd_fd, &stb) < 0)
     76 		goto bad;
     77 
     78 	/*
     79 	 * estimate the array size by taking the size of the directory file
     80 	 * and dividing it by a multiple of the minimum size entry.
     81 	 */
     82 	arraysz = (size_t)(stb.st_size / 24);
     83 	names = malloc(arraysz * sizeof(struct dirent *));
     84 	if (names == NULL)
     85 		goto bad;
     86 
     87 	nitems = 0;
     88 	while ((d = readdir(dirp)) != NULL) {
     89 		if (selectfn != NULL && !(*selectfn)(d))
     90 			continue;	/* just selected names */
     91 
     92 		/*
     93 		 * Check to make sure the array has space left and
     94 		 * realloc the maximum size.
     95 		 */
     96 		if (nitems >= arraysz) {
     97 			if (fstat(dirp->dd_fd, &stb) < 0)
     98 				goto bad2;	/* just might have grown */
     99 			arraysz = (size_t)(stb.st_size / 12);
    100 			newnames = realloc(names,
    101 			    arraysz * sizeof(struct dirent *));
    102 			if (newnames == NULL)
    103 				goto bad2;
    104 			names = newnames;
    105 		}
    106 
    107 		/*
    108 		 * Make a minimum size copy of the data
    109 		 */
    110 		p = (struct dirent *)malloc((size_t)_DIRENT_SIZE(d));
    111 		if (p == NULL)
    112 			goto bad2;
    113 		p->d_fileno = d->d_fileno;
    114 		p->d_reclen = d->d_reclen;
    115 		p->d_type = d->d_type;
    116 		p->d_namlen = d->d_namlen;
    117 		memmove(p->d_name, d->d_name, (size_t)(p->d_namlen + 1));
    118 		names[nitems++] = p;
    119 	}
    120 	closedir(dirp);
    121 	if (nitems && dcomp != NULL)
    122 		qsort(names, nitems, sizeof(struct dirent *), dcomp);
    123 	*namelist = names;
    124 	return (nitems);
    125 
    126 bad2:
    127 	while (nitems-- > 0)
    128 		free(names[nitems]);
    129 	free(names);
    130 bad:
    131 	closedir(dirp);
    132 	return (-1);
    133 }
